Take-Two To Co-Publish Sega ESPN Games
8th June 2004, 11:09pm
Take-Two and Sega have announced that they have signed a letter of intent that would see Take-Two co-publish and exclusively distribute worldwide all Sega ESPN sports titels including ESPN NFL Football, ESPN NHL Hockey, ESPN NBA Basketball plus many more. These games will be distributed through Jack of All Games in North America and Take-Two Europe for international territories. The agreement is a multi-year agreement with the option of Take-Two able to extend the agreement.
